Every year, APAICS hosts a Leadership Academy for Elected Officials. This Leadership Academy brings together elected APA officials from around the nation, allowing them to network and learn from others who have come before them.
The 2007 APAICS Leadership Academy brought together the following distinguished individuals for three days of dialouge and discourse:
Mailo Atonio (D) - 6th District, Senator, Legislature of American Samoa
Ken Chew (D) - Council Member, Town of Moraga, California
Sue Chew (D) - State Representative, Idaho
Jerry B. Clarito (D) - Skokie Park District Commissioner, Skokie, Illinois
Jose Owen R. Diaz (R) - Mayor, City of Milan, Michigan
Charles Kong Djou (R) - Councilmember, Honolulu City, Hawaii
Laura Lee (D) - Mayor, City of Cerritos, California
Andrew M. Luzod (I) - Mayor, City of Melvindale, Michigan
Michael Park (I) - Mayor, City of Federal Way, Washington
Norman Sakamoto (D) - Majority Whip, Hawaii State Senate
Michelle Park Steel (R) - State Board of Equalization Member, California
Aitofele T. Sunia (I) - Lieutenant Governor of American Samoa
